加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(http://www.zzredu.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

SQL优化与高效数据库构建实战

发布时间:2025-12-16 13:21:10 所属栏目:MsSql教程 来源:DaWei
导读:  在小程序原生开发中,数据库的性能直接影响到用户体验和系统稳定性。尤其是在数据量较大的场景下,SQL优化显得尤为重要。作为开发者,我们不仅要关注代码逻辑的正确性,更要注重数据库操作的效率。  理解索引的

  在小程序原生开发中,数据库的性能直接影响到用户体验和系统稳定性。尤其是在数据量较大的场景下,SQL优化显得尤为重要。作为开发者,我们不仅要关注代码逻辑的正确性,更要注重数据库操作的效率。


  理解索引的作用是优化SQL的基础。合理使用索引可以大幅减少查询时间,但过多或不当的索引反而会增加写入成本。因此,在设计表结构时,需要根据实际查询需求来选择合适的字段建立索引。


  避免全表扫描是提升查询效率的关键。通过分析执行计划,我们可以发现哪些查询没有使用索引,进而调整SQL语句或优化索引策略。同时,尽量避免在WHERE子句中使用函数或表达式,这可能导致索引失效。


2025建议图AI生成,仅供参考

  合理使用连接(JOIN)操作也需要注意。虽然JOIN能有效整合多个表的数据,但过多的JOIN或不合理的连接条件会导致查询性能下降。在可能的情况下,可以通过预处理数据或引入冗余字段来减少复杂连接。


  在构建高效数据库时,数据类型的选择同样不可忽视。例如,使用INT而非VARCHAR存储数字,不仅节省空间,还能提高查询速度。同时,遵循数据库范式原则,合理设计表结构,避免数据冗余和更新异常。


  定期对数据库进行维护,如重建索引、清理无用数据等,有助于保持系统的最佳运行状态。结合实际业务场景,制定合理的监控和优化策略,能够持续提升数据库性能。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章